How To Fix 0D785 - Change to contract account only possible using master data change


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: 0D - FS-CD General Messages

  • Message number: 785

  • Message text: Change to contract account only possible using master data change

  • Show details Hide details
  • What causes this issue?

    You want to change the account assignment from &V2& to &V3& for
    contract &V1&.

    System Response

    The system issues an error message and will not allow you to continue with this transaction until the error is resolved.

    How to fix this error?

    This change is only possible using the change to contract &V1&. Enter
    the new account assignment there for business partner &V4&. This
    transfers the posting data.

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message 0D785 - Change to contract account only possible using master data change ?

    The SAP error message 0D785 ("Change to contract account only possible using master data change") typically occurs when there is an attempt to change certain attributes of a contract account in a way that is not allowed through the standard transaction or interface being used. This error is often related to the management of contract accounts in the SAP system, particularly in the context of financial accounting or contract management.

    Cause:

    1. Inappropriate Change Attempt: The error usually arises when a user tries to change specific fields or attributes of a contract account that are restricted from being modified directly through the transaction being used.
    2. Master Data Restrictions: Certain changes to contract accounts can only be made through designated master data transactions, which ensure that the integrity of the data is maintained.
    3. Configuration Settings: The system may be configured to restrict changes to certain fields based on business rules or compliance requirements.

    Solution:

    1. Use the Correct Transaction: To resolve this error, you should use the appropriate master data transaction to make the necessary changes. For example, if you need to change the contract account details, you may need to use transactions like:

      • FP02 (Change Contract Account)
      • FPL1 (Create Contract Account)
      • FPL2 (Display Contract Account)
    2. Check Authorization: Ensure that you have the necessary authorizations to make changes to contract accounts. If you lack the required permissions, contact your system administrator.

    3. Consult Documentation: Review the SAP documentation or help files related to contract account management to understand which fields can be changed and through which transactions.

    4. Contact Support: If you are unsure about the changes you need to make or if the error persists, consider reaching out to your SAP support team or consulting with an SAP expert.
